As the title indicates, this form is a sample of an employment contract between an employee and employer in the technology business. It contains both a nondisclosure section as well as a noncompetition section. This form also provides a definition of the phrase trade secrets. Overview of Employment Contracts: An employment contract is a legally binding agreement that outlines the rights, responsibilities, and obligations of both the employer and the employee. In Los Angeles, California, these contracts must adhere to state and federal labor laws, including but not limited to those applicable to the technology industry. 2. At-Will Employment Contracts: At-will employment contracts are commonly used in the technology business in Los Angeles. These contracts establish an employment relationship where either the employer or the employee has the freedom to terminate the employment at any time, with or without cause or notice. Fixed-term Employment Contracts: Fixed-term employment contracts are another type utilized in the technology industry in Los Angeles. These contracts have a predetermined duration, specifying the exact start and end dates of the employment. The terms and conditions regarding termination are typically outlined within the contract. Non-disclosure Agreements (NDAs): In the technology business, protecting sensitive information is of utmost importance. Non-disclosure agreements are often incorporated into employment contracts to safeguard trade secrets, proprietary software, client lists, or any other confidential information related to the employer's business. Intellectual Property Clauses: Given the technology industry's focus on innovation and intellectual property, employment contracts may include specific clauses regarding ownership and protection of intellectual property. These clauses ensure that any inventions, discoveries, or creations made by the employee during their employment belong to the employer. Non-Compete Agreements: Non-compete agreements are contracts that restrict employees from engaging in competitive activities or working for direct competitors for a certain period after leaving their current employer. In Los Angeles, California, non-compete agreements must adhere to specific legal requirements to be enforceable.
